Mastering the Economy: Effective Resource Management in CS2
Mastering the economy in CS2 is crucial for players looking to enhance their gameplay experience and overall team performance. Effective resource management involves understanding how to allocate your in-game currency wisely, ensuring that you can afford essential weapons, armor, and utility items when needed. By prioritizing communication with your teammates, you can create a strategy that maximizes your collective resources. Implementing a buying strategy that considers each player's role can significantly improve your team's chances of success.
To further master resource management, players should focus on map control and positioning. Recognizing when to save versus when to invest in expensive items is vital for sustaining your team's economy over multiple rounds. Establishing a balance between aggression and conservativeness allows for a more resilient approach to the game's economy. Remember, even a single successful round can turn the tide, highlighting the importance of effective resource management in CS2 and paving the way for victory.

Top 5 Map Control Strategies for CS2 Success
In Counter-Strike 2, mastering map control is pivotal for achieving victory. One of the most effective strategies is maintaining constant communication with your teammates to ensure everyone is aware of enemy positions and movements. This approach not only enhances your team's situational awareness but also helps in coordinating pushes and defensive holds. Additionally, utilizing utility effectively, such as smoke grenades and flashbangs, can significantly alter sightlines and provide the necessary cover for taking control of key areas.
Another crucial strategy involves controlling high ground and choke points on the map. High grounds provide a tactical advantage, allowing players to spot enemies from a distance while minimizing exposure. Prioritize map areas like banana in Inferno or mid on Dust II, as these are critical to map dominance. Lastly, always be adaptable; adjusting your tactics based on how the match progresses can give you the upper hand. Remember, the key to success in CS2 lies in effective map control and teamwork.
How to Analyze Opponents: Reading Team Composition and Playstyles in CS2
Understanding how to analyze opponents in CS2 is crucial for gaining a competitive edge. Start by evaluating the team composition of your adversaries. This involves examining the roles of each player—like whether they are using typical entry fraggers, support characters, or heavy hitters. You can categorize the players into groups, such as:
- Entry Fraggers: Those who lead the charge and take the initial confrontation.
- Support Players: Individuals who provide utility and backup to their team.
- Snipers: Players who hold long angles and provide intelligence from a distance.
Next, you need to consider the playstyles that your opponents typically adopt. This can vary widely, from aggressive strategies that pressure the map to more defensive setups that rely on patience and information gathering. Pay attention to their movement patterns, how they execute strategies, and their response to certain situations. You can categorize these into:
- Aggressive Play: Teams that rush and overwhelm the enemy from the outset.
- Defensive Play: Teams that prefer to hold back and create counter-play opportunities.
- Adaptive Play: Teams that shift strategies based on the state of the match.
